Anti-FAM115A antibodies enable researchers to detect and measure the FAM115A antigen in biological samples. This target is a reported synonym of the TCAF1 gene, which encodes TRPM8 channel associated factor 1. This protein is known to function in the regulation of cell migration, among other biological roles. The human version of FAM115A has a canonical amino acid length of 921 residues and a protein mass of 102.1 kilodaltons, although 2 isoforms have been identified. It is reported to be localized in the cell membrane of cells and widely expressed in many tissue types. FAM115A is a member of the TCAF protein family.
